Hajarpur - Maker, Saran

Hajarpur is a village situated in the Maker subdivision of Saran district, Bihar. It is located approximately 10 km from the tehsil headquarters in Maker and around 50 km from the district headquarters in Chhapra. Bagha Kol serves as the Gram Panchayat for Hajarpur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Hajarpur is 233995. The village covers a total geographical area of 227 hectares and falls under the 841215 pincode. Chapra is the nearest town, located about 39 km away.

Hajarp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Hajarpur

As per Census 2011, Hajarpur village has a total population of 2,072 people, consisting of 1,047 males and 1,025 females. The village has 385 households and a sex ratio of 978 females per 1,000 males. There are 358 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,066 literate and 1,006 illiterate residents. Additionally, 529 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Hajarpur

Hajarp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Terha Halt, while the nearest airport is Muzaffarpur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 29.2 km.
